| Sr Licensing Coordinator Needed in Calabasas | |
| Job Description The Senior Licensing Compliance Coordinator is responsible for assisting with the development, maintenance, and execution of department processes and procedures to ensure company compliance with local jurisdiction licensing codes and ordinances related to Residential Property Management, Rental Registrations, Rental Inspections, and New ConstructionDevelopment activity. This position interacts with various external business entities such as City, Village, County, and Assessor personnel and coordinates activity across several internal departments to ensure compliance in over 1,300 jurisdictions for over 60,000 single family residential rental homes and offices operating as multiple legal entities. Manage a portfolio with complex business and rental licensing requirements to ensure legal compliance, including researching, maintaining, and updating property jurisdiction locales and relevant ordinances. Document jurisdiction requirements, recommend process updates, create, and renew owner, rental, and property management business licenses, rental and occupancy registrations, and rental inspections applications. Gather data from accounting or other records to calculate fees, create payment support, and process invoices for Owner, Property Management, and General Contractor entities. Create packages to include tenant information, leases, and other information as required for jurisdiction compliance. Maintain license status, local requirements, and other records using a custom licensing database and workflow. Manage the Rental Inspection process where required, coordinating with various stakeholders Resident and Property Management, In-House Maintenance Scheduling, Home Maintenance Services, Accounts Payable, Jurisdiction Inspector, and Jurisdiction administrators to ensure progress until the property inspection is Passed, all payments are processed, and Certificate of Occupancy is issued. Coordinate and host conference calls with local teams to document inspection updates | |
